Penelitian ini mengangkat masalah mengenai fenomena kerusakan lingkungan beserta relasinya dengan manusia dalam cerpen “Pohon Pongo”. Tujuan penelitian ini mendeskripsikan bentuk fenomena kerusakan lingkungan dan hubungan manusia dengan lingkungan dalam cerpen “Pohon Pongo” karya Rinto Andriono. Data primer penelitian ini bersumber dari laman Dalang Publishing yang dikaji dengan menggunakan pendekatan ekokritik.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a dalam cerpen “Pohon Pongo” karya Rinto Andriono terdapat 1) bentuk relasi manusia dan lingkungan, berupa sikap tanggung jawab moral dan kasih sayang dan peduli terhadap alam, 2) bentuk kerusakan lingkungan yang meliputi penebangan dan pembakaran hutan untuk perluasan lahan perkebunan, pencemaran udara, dan kekerasan terhadap satwa, 3) kajian ekologi budaya yang berupa kebiasaan atau kepercayaan masyarakat yang memepercayai adanya Sang Roh Rimba.

ABSTRACT Iron deficiency is a problem that often occurs in the elderly as a result of the aging process. The use of Moringa oleifera leaf to occupy the need of nutritious meal which highly in vitamin and mineral especially iron was scarce. This research aim was to determine the influence of Moringa oleifera leaf powder on hemoglobin levels in the elderly. The pre-experimental research design was used to the sample of 16 respondents which were selected by consecutive sampling technique. The result showed the majority of the respondent were female within average of 65 years old. The paired T-test analysis obtained the hemoglobin levels was 13.76 g/dL (before Moringa oleifera leaf powder consumed) and increase after consumption to 15.13 g/dL (p-value of 0.031 0.05). It indicates there is an influence of Moringa oleifera leaf powder on hemoglobin levels in the elderly. It is recommended to further study the effect of Moringa oleifera leaf powder on the blood chemistry and SpO2 levels among the elder population. Diabetes mellitus is a collection of metabolic symptoms starting with insulin secretion or insulin resistance. Insulin resistance in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us (T2DM) sufferers causes a decrease in the absorption of glucose levels. The liver cytosol is a source of glucose energy obtained from fatty acid synthesis. This synthesis event causes "fatty liver", namely the accumulation of lipids in the liver, this is very dangerous and in an effort to prevent the severity of this disease it is necessary to check liver enzymes, namely SGPT and SGOT in T2DM sufferers. This study aims to analyse the correlation of liver enzymes SGPT and SGOT in T2DM sufferers. This research has a collative design with an approach to collecting data on variable blood sugar levels and liver enzymes SGOT and SGPT at one time which is called a cross-sectional approach. The total sample was 25 patients taken using purposive sampling technique. The observation sheet is used as an instrument to collect data. This research resulted in the highest number of studies showing 56% of abnormal blood glucose levels with abnormal SGPT liver enzymes. There is no correlation between blood glucose levels and the liver enzyme SGPT in T2DM sufferers with a p-value of 0.54. The highest abnormal blood glucose level is 4% with abnormal SGOT liver enzymes. There is no correlation between blood glucose levels and the liver enzyme SGOT in T2DM sufferers with a p-value of 0.28. The conclusion of the study was that there was no correlation between the liver enzymes SGPT and SGOT in T2DM sufferers.

This article examines the challenges and opportunities for students of English Literature in Indonesia amidst forces of globalization and technological advancements in most aspects of life. Demographic transition of users and providers of the English language has brought about such challenges as observable lack of maturity in English scholarship and automation’s impact on education today. It can be argued that such challenges can be seen as opportunities by a creative rather than product-oriented curriculum. Given that studying literature is not only to train cognitive skills of interpreting texts, English Literature teaching in Indonesia should also impart values so as to inspire learners into becoming autonomous, self-fulfilled and emancipated global citizen. Opportunities are open if studying English Literature can include humanistic-contextual topics, discerning use of technology and transformative research method.

This article is of reflection category exploring the common mistakes often occur in translating Indonesian literary texts into English by a non-native speaker of English. It argues that translation of literary texts is meticulous as it should involve interpretation and fluency in both source and target languages as well as creativity in order that the translated texts communicate equally well. It is the communicative power of translation that makes this undertaking of language transfer miraculous. Applying sufficient principles in translation and creative writing method, this article exemplifies the translation process of Mochtar Lubis’s short story “Kuli Kontrak” into “The Contract Coolies” that appears in the Your Story page of California-based Dalang Publishing bi-lingual website. Autoethnography is the method used in reporting the results. Three main problems that ensue in the Indonesian-English translation of this short story include (1) the concept of time, (2) the non-idiomatic use of body-parts, and (3) the unnecessary use of object construction/ passive voice that often do not translate well in English. By tackling these problems, the English reader may hopefully obtain the meaning-message of the short story as closely as possible to that acquired by Indonesian readers.

This study looks at how rivers, resistance and women’s struggle intertwine with each other in 3 fictions set in, respectively, Indonesia, Malaysia and Vietnam. Not only has a river become life-giving forces, but it is also a locus of diverse social conflicts where women are often the most victimized yet survived. Making use of ecofeminism and related theoretical concepts such as Pope Francis’ encyclical Laudato si’ on the environment and human ecology, this study examines the female characters and their ordeals in the three fictions discussed. This study reveals that first, ecological economy depends on water sustainability where women try very hard to protect nature against degradation. Secondly, abuse of women is seen in parallel with abuse of nature. In the end, this study concludes that the women’ resistance against patriarchy confirms the theoretical relevance of ecofeminism for the reading of Southeast Asian fictions.
